    <description>Old discharged cheques, vouchers, deeds, agreements and account books stored for banks and corporate houses were held not to be &quot;goods&quot; for storage and warehousing service tax purposes. The applicable statutory meaning of goods was drawn from the Sale of Goods Act, where saleability and marketability are essential attributes; records kept for compliance and record management lacked those attributes. On that basis, storing and managing such records did not fall within storage and warehousing of goods, so service tax was not payable on the activity.</description>
